Question
Briefly describe the extraction of minerals.

Answer

Minerals are mainly extracted by mining, drilling or quarrying:
  1. Mining: The process of taking out minerals from rocks buried under the earth’s surface is called mining. There are two types of mining:
  1. Open cast mining- Open cast mining refers to the method of extraction in which minerals lying at shallow depths are taken out by removing the surface layer.
  2. Shaft mining- Shaft mining refers to the method of extraction in which deep bores called shafts, have to be made to reach mineral deposits that lie at great depths.
  1. Drilling: Deep wells are bored to take minerals out, is called drilling.
  2. Quarrying: In process of quarrying, minerals that lie near the surface are simply dug out.
